Subsequent iPod nano models do not support Firewire at all and the iPod touch and iPod shuffle models do not support Firewire either. Also see: Which iPods can sync and charge via USB? Which iPods can sync and charge via Firewire? Can I directly connect two iPods to each other and transfer music? Apple provides no support for such a feature.

IEEE 1394 is an interface standard for a serial bus for high-speed communications and isochronous real-time data transfer. It was developed in the late 1980s and early 1990s by Apple, which called it FireWire, in cooperation with a number of companies, primarily Sony and Panasonic.The 1394 interface is also known by the brands i.LINK (Sony), and Lynx (Texas Instruments).Designer: Apple (1394a/b), IEEE P1394 Working …
